As you have seen from many of my testing videos, the weak point in any waterproof membrane material for a shower pan is at the seams where the sheet and band come together. These polyethylene sheet membranes for tile rely on thinset mortar to adhere the banding and corners at the junctions of the sheets. We know the various brands of membrane as schluter Kerdi, Ardex SK-175, and Hydro Ban Sheet Membrane. As we know, regular thinset mortar is not waterproof, so if water sits on one of the seam areas for prolonged periods of time, the water can seep through the layers of waterproof membrane. To eliminate the seams in the shower pan area, you can implement a fold and tuck technique similar to how a PVC pan liner is used. This video shows how to do that, plus a few additional tips and tricks for waterproof membranes for tiled showers.
